Hexb Gene Summary [Rat]

Enables beta-N-acetylglucosaminidase activity; carbohydrate binding activity; and identical protein binding activity. Involved in N-acetylglucosamine metabolic process. Predicted to be located in extracellular space and secretory granule. Predicted to be part of beta-N-acetylhexosaminidase complex. Predicted to be active in lysosome and membrane. Human ortholog(s) of this gene implicated in Sandhoff disease and spinal muscular atrophy. Orthologous to human HEXB (hexosaminidase subunit beta).
